One of Ghana’s biggest markets has been gutted by fire. In a devastating start to the year for traders at Kantomanto market in Accra, over 100 shops and all within were  destroyed on Thursday morning as flames ripped through the closely packed stalls, many business owners say that they have lost everything. Its still not clear what started the blaze. It’s not the first time that the congested hub has been decimated by fire. FRANCE 24’s correspondent, Justice Baidoo has more.
